The Challenges of Using Hermes for Bicycle Shipping:

While Hermes offers a relatively inexpensive shipping solution for smaller packages, sending a bicycle presents unique challenges. Their standard packaging and handling procedures might not adequately protect a bike from the rigors of transit. A bicycle, even a relatively inexpensive one, contains numerous delicate components – derailleurs, brakes, handlebars, wheels – which are susceptible to damage during rough handling or impacts. Furthermore, the lack of specialized insurance options for bicycles with Hermes can leave you financially vulnerable in case of damage or loss. This is particularly relevant when shipping high-value bikes, exceeding even €1000, as the standard insurance coverage offered by Hermes might be insufficient. Superior Alternatives to Hermes for Fahrradversand:

Instead of relying on a general parcel service like Hermes, several superior alternatives exist specifically designed for shipping bicycles. These options usually offer better protection, more comprehensive insurance, and specialized handling procedures that minimize the risk of damage. Let's explore some key alternatives:

1. Specialized Bicycle Shipping Companies:

These companies specialize in transporting bicycles and understand the specific requirements for safe and secure shipment. They often provide custom-built crates or boxes designed to protect your bike from damage during transit. These crates are generally more robust than those you might find at a local bike shop. They offer various levels of insurance tailored to the value of your bike, providing peace of mind in case of accidents. The added cost is often justified by the reduced risk of damage and the comprehensive insurance coverage. 2. Utilizing the Original Bike Box:

As mentioned in the initial prompt, reusing the original bicycle box is a significantly better option than using a generic Hermes box. "Deutlich besser ist es beim nächsten Fahrradhändler einen Radkarton abzustauben und das Rad darin zu verschicken," translates to "It's significantly better to dust off a bike box from the next bike shop and ship the bike in it." Bike shops often have spare boxes, and obtaining one is often free or at a minimal cost. This approach provides a much better fit for your bicycle, offering superior protection compared to repurposed cardboard boxes. Remember to adequately pad the bike within the box using bubble wrap, foam, or other protective materials. This method combines cost-effectiveness with significantly improved safety.
